Bake the bread at 425°F for 15 minutes. Then reduce the heat to 375°F and bake for 17 to 20 minutes more for smaller loaves, or 25 to 30 minutes more for a single large loaf. (Baking the dough initially at a higher temperature will give your bread an immediate lift, called "oven spring.") This will make sure that you get a nice even bake. The optimal temperature for baking rye bread is 350°-400°F until it achieves an internal temperature of 205°-210°F. Begin by preheating the oven at 450°F. Then lower the temperatures to 400°F and bake the bread for an initial 15 minutes. Lower the temperatures to 350°F and bake for 20-25 minutes.The best temperature for baking rye bread is 350 degrees Fahrenheit. This temperature will ensure that the bread bakes evenly and thoroughly. Be sure to use a digital thermometer to check the internal temperature of the bread before removing it from the oven. The correct temperature range for baking bread varies depending on the type of bread you’re making. As mentioned earlier, sandwich breads typically bake between 350°F and 375°F (175°C to 190°C), while artisan breads require higher temperatures ranging from 400°F to 450°F (200°C to 230°C). 1.
